Influence on Individual Actions



Shade options in site style can directly affect how customers act and communicate with the material presented. When customers see an internet site, the colors made use of can evoke certain feelings and reactions that impact their browsing experience. For example, cozy colors like red and orange can produce a feeling of urgency or enjoyment, triggering customers to take action quickly. On the other hand, amazing colors such as blue and eco-friendly tend to have a calming effect, perfect for promoting leisure or count on.

Making use of contrasting colors can draw attention to crucial components on a page, guiding users in the direction of certain areas like switches or phones call to action. Similarly, a well-thought-out color design can enhance readability and navigation, making it much easier for individuals to find info and engage with the material. By strategically incorporating shades that align with your website's purpose and target market, you can efficiently affect individual actions and improve overall interaction.
